Any action to avoid collision shall be positive, made in ample time, and with due regard to the observance of good seamanship, passing at a safe distance, ensure safety until vessels have passed and cleared safely. There is a basic order, in the navigation rules, that governs who stays out of the way of whom. The navigation rules distinguish one vessel from another by both its design, and by its actions. The effective date for the inland navigation rules was december 24, 1981, except for the great lakes where the effective date was march 1, 1983. The international regulations for preventing collisions at sea 1972 colregs are published by the international maritime organization imo and set out, among other things, the rules of the road or navigation rules to be followed by ships and other vessels at sea to prevent collisions between two or more vessels. Navigation rules contains a complete copy of the international regulations for preventing collisions at sea, 1972 colregs, including amendments and the inland navigation rules, in effect for all inland waters, including the great lakes.
